Receiving Payments in Ripple (XRP)238
In the rapidly evolving world of digital payments, Ripple (XRP) has emerged as a promising contender for cross-border transactions. Its advantages, such as low transaction fees, high transaction speed, and scalable architecture, make it a viable and cost-effective option for businesses and individuals alike.
If you're looking to receive payments in XRP, the process is relatively straightforward and involves the following steps:
Step 1: Create a Ripple Wallet
To receive XRP payments, you'll need a Ripple wallet to store your funds. Several reputable wallets are available, including the official Ripple wallet, Xumm, and Trust Wallet. Choose one that meets your security and functionality requirements.
Step 2: Get Your Ripple Address
Once you've created your wallet, you'll need to obtain your XRP address. This is a unique identifier that allows others to send XRP to your wallet. The format of an XRP address is similar to an email address or a bitcoin wallet address.
Step 3: Share Your XRP Address
Once you have your XRP address, share it with anyone who wishes to send you payments. You can include it in invoices, on your website, or via email. Ensure you're sharing the correct address to avoid any potential issues.
Step 4: Receive XRP Payments
When someone sends you XRP, it will be reflected in your wallet balance. Transactions typically process quickly, usually within seconds. You can then use your XRP to make purchases, exchange it for other cryptocurrencies, or hold it as an investment.
Benefits of Receiving XRP Payments
Receiving payments in XRP offers several advantages, including:
Fast and efficient transactions: XRP transactions are processed almost instantly, making it a suitable option for time-sensitive payments.
Low transaction fees: Unlike some other cryptocurrencies, XRP transactions have minimal fees, often just a fraction of a cent.
Global reach: XRP is a global cryptocurrency, allowing for payments to be sent and received across borders without intermediaries.
Investment potential: While receiving payments in XRP is primarily about convenience, it also offers the potential for investment gains as the value of XRP fluctuates.
Conclusion
Receiving payments in XRP is a convenient, cost-effective, and secure way to manage your finances and conduct cross-border transactions. By following the steps outlined above, you can easily establish your Ripple wallet and start receiving XRP payments.
